Output 2520397a8c8e8712218179fd81eb3bbb8ce091aa3d32931163f85eaa857ac770:99

value
87993
script pubkey
OP_0 OP_PUSHBYTES_20 db29349466d1a25cb9d47c64c8717f579c8b58fa
address
bc1qmv5nf9rx6x39eww503jvsutl27wgkk86klzp5w
transaction
2520397a8c8e8712218179fd81eb3bbb8ce091aa3d32931163f85eaa857ac770
spent
true